    Just a quick photodump of our weekend at the Kamiseta Hotel, Baguio

    Almost one year ago, I and my friends at work took a half day Friday leave and spent the weekend in Baguio to have a little break and unwind. Well aside from spending time at the thrift shops, we really had a great time food tripping. And of course, after all the hard work at the office and loooong walks along the streets of Baguio, we just deserved taking a good rest in a beautiful hotel and one of the most photographed hotels in Baguio – the Kamiseta Hotel.     Punta Riviera Resort: one place you shouldn’t miss in Bolinao

    It’s no news that Philippines has thousands of beautiful, tropical islands that local and tourists alike find really enchanted. Beyond all the beaches and resorts and natural beauty the country has to offer, another part of the culture we Filipinos are always proud of is our Pinoy food. And if there’s one local cuisine you should not miss, it is the cooking in Pangasinan. I recently had the chance to roam around one of Pangasinan’s towns, Bolinao, and from the moment that I stepped off my shuttle, I knew that I was going to love the place! Why?
